Property Description

Corner Cottage is a truly unique home that doesn’t quite fit the usual bungalow mould. The original part of the house is thought to date back to the mid nineteenth century, while an extension added in 1987 has given it considerably more space than you’d expect. There are two further rooms within the converted attic that add to the versatility making it an interesting home with plenty of character.

From the street, the cottage has a traditional look with cream rendered walls, a pitched slate roof and mahogany effect window frames. The front porch creates a bright entrance before you step through into the house itself. From here, the hallway takes you through the ground floor with natural timber doors and matching trim adding warmth against the lighter coloured walls.

In the lounge, a wood burning stove immediately catches the eye, set into the fireplace which sits against a deep green feature wall. The remaining walls are finished in warm neutral tones and there are windows to the front and rear which bring daylight into the space.

The dining room is separate with a distinct identity of its own. One wall has an intricate patterned wallpaper while the rest of the room is kept neutral, with a deep window bringing in natural light. It’s easily large enough for a full dining table and chairs with space around for additional furniture.

The kitchen has a cottage inspired finish. Cream Shaker style cabinets run around the room with solid timber worktops above. The room also has a traditional Belfast style sink that adds to the atmosphere. Timber shelving and natural wood detailing continue the warmer look, while there’s space for a freestanding cooker, washing machine and fridge freezer.

The two ground floor bedrooms have their own distinct look. The first bedroom has a warm, traditional feel, with a muted tartan feature wall setting the tone against light brown walls. It’s a comfortable double, with the window bringing in plenty of daylight and enough space around the room for storage without it feeling crowded.

The second bedroom feels quite different. A deep blue coloured wall gives the room a bold look, while a full run of built in timber fronted wardrobes across one side provides plenty of storage. The remaining walls are kept light and the wide window helps keep the room bright.

The shower room has a large walk in enclosure sitting in one corner. Beige stone effect tiles cover the walls around the shower, where both overhead and handheld fittings have been installed. The toilet and pedestal basin sit beneath the window on the opposite side, leaving plenty of clear space through the centre of the room.

The home also has a convenient WC. Here, a round bowl shaped basin sits on a timber worktop with traditional style taps, while painted timber panelling runs around the lower section of the walls.

The attic is where Corner Cottage becomes a little more unusual. Access is via a fixed step ladder from the hallway, through a ceiling opening. Once upstairs, the roof space has been fully floored and lined, with central heating and double glazing already installed. A small landing connects the two attic rooms, with a rooflight bringing daylight into the space. Both rooms sit beneath the roof slopes and are large enough to accommodate beds and additional furniture. Each has its own window and radiator, with timber doors and skirtings continuing the natural finish used elsewhere in the house.

Outside, the cottage sits on a corner plot enclosed largely by walls, with areas of lawn wrapping around the front and side. Behind the property is a timber decked veranda covered by a Perspex roof, creating a sheltered outside area beside the outbuildings. These include a timber garage and two additional timber sheds, giving you a whole lot of storage space. A tarmac driveway provides off street parking alongside.

Corner Cottage has plenty of character and more space than its traditional bungalow appearance might suggest. The attic rooms give you useful extra space, while the mature corner garden and village setting add to the appeal outside. About Garmouth

Garmouth is a charming coastal village in Moray, located near the mouth of the River Spey. With a rich history and a peaceful rural atmosphere, it offers an appealing lifestyle for those looking to settle in a scenic part of the world.

The village has a unique layout of winding streets and traditional buildings, giving it a characterful feel. Garmouth is known for its community spirit, with events such as the long-running Maggie Fair playing a central role in village life. Outdoor enthusiasts will enjoy the local walking and cycling routes, including a path across the Spey Viaduct with beautiful views towards Kingston and the coast. There’s also a local golf club offering a relaxed setting to play.

While Garmouth itself is quiet and friendly, the larger town of Elgin is just 9 miles away and provides a full range of amenities including supermarkets, healthcare services, shops, restaurants and schools.

With its coastal setting, access to nature and close-knit community, Garmouth is a fantastic option for those seeking a slower pace of life in a beautiful and historic part of Scotland.

Anti-money Laundering Legislation
As with all Estate Agents, Hamish is subject to Anti Money Laundering Regulations. These regulations require us as selling agents, to perform various checks on the property buyers and any offer presented to us must be accompanied by the current address, date of birth, and of proof of funds for all purchasers and of any family members who may be gifting deposits. From time to time, certified photographic evidence of the buyer’s identity and proof of address may also be required. We are unable to progress any sale to completion, until these requirements have been fully satisfied.

Our Closing Date Policy
While a closing date may be set for the sale of the property, there is no legal obligation to do so—even when multiple parties have expressed interest. Hamish retains the right to act on their client’s instructions and accept an offer at any time, without establishing a closing date or notifying other interested parties.

Prospective buyers who have formally registered their interest through their solicitors in writing will be informed if a closing date is set. However, this notification will not occur if an offer has already been accepted.
